What to Check When an Outlet Stops Working?

Chris Miller Electric can help find the cause of a dead outlet. Many homeowners can start with a few safe checks. First, check the plug-in device, breaker, and nearby GFCI receptacle. If a reset doesn’t restore power, the outlet may have a loose wire or damaged part. The problem may also need an electrician.

Plug a lamp into a different working outlet. If the lamp also fails, the lamp or cord may be bad. If only one outlet fails, look for a nearby GFCI receptacle. Check bathrooms, kitchens, garages, and laundry areas. Also check basements and outdoor locations. One GFCI can cut power to other outlets farther along the same circuit.

Look at the circuit breaker panel. Find a switch between the “on” and “off” positions. Resetting it may restore power. Repeated trips may show an overload, short circuit, or wiring fault. Signs an Outlet Needs Electrical Repair

Electrical repair is needed when an outlet looks damaged or acts strangely. Burn marks, heat, buzzing, and sparks are warning signs. A loose faceplate can also signal trouble, so can a plug that won’t stay in place. These signs may point to heat, wiring damage, or a failing receptacle.

Burn marks or dark spots appear on the faceplate or receptacle.
Sparking happens when you insert, remove, or move a plug.
The receptacle feels hot or smells burnt.
The outlet is loose or cracked.
The faceplate won’t stay secure.
Power comes and goes, or the plug won’t stay inserted.
Buzzing, crackling, smoke, or visible electrical arcing is present.

Turn off the circuit if you can do so safely. Keep people away from the area. Then request professional service. Don’t use water on an electrical fire. Don’t touch an outlet exposed to water. Our team can check the receptacle, wiring, and safety devices before making a repair.

Common Reasons a Receptacle Has No Power

A powerless electrical outlet often has a simple cause. A tripped breaker, GFCI, or failed outlet may be to blame. A loose wire or overloaded circuit can also stop power. The right repair starts with testing. Replacing the receptacle alone may not fix the real fault.

A loose connection can stop power without visible damage. An older outlet may have a failed inner part. Too many heaters, tools, or appliances can overload one circuit. A failed outlet may also point to a larger residential wiring service issue.

An electrician checks the whole branch circuit. This helps find a failed GFCI, burned receptacle, or loose wire. It also helps find a breaker or neutral problem. A homeowner may safely reset a device. Unclear, repeated, or unsafe faults need professional electrical diagnosis.

Four Common Causes to Investigate

Circuit breaker: A tripped or bad breaker may cut power to the circuit.
GFCI protection: A tripped GFCI can cut power to several outlets.
Backstab connection: A wire pushed into a spring terminal may loosen over time.
Open neutral: A broken neutral wire can make an outlet test wrong or stay dead.

These problems can look the same from the outside. Testing is safer than replacing parts based on symptoms alone.

Safe Troubleshooting Steps Before Calling an Electrician

Safe outlet troubleshooting starts with unplugging devices. Test the device at a working outlet. Find and reset a nearby GFCI. Then check the right circuit breaker. Don’t remove the receptacle or touch open wires unless you’re qualified. Stop at once if you see heat, smoke, sparks, or water. Stop if the breaker trips again.

1
Unplug appliances and move the device to a working outlet.
2
Find nearby GFCI devices and press the reset button once. Stop if it won’t reset.
3
At the breaker panel, move the suspected breaker fully off, then on. Don’t force the switch.
4
Use an electrical tester only if you know how it works. Keep the area dry. A voltage tester can find some live circuits. It doesn’t make open wires safe.
5
Turn off the circuit before any inspection. Keep others from turning it back on.

How an Electrician Diagnoses a Dead Outlet?

An electrician starts by confirming the problem. They test for voltage and trace the branch circuit. They check line and load connections. They inspect the neutral wire and breaker. These steps help separate a failed receptacle from a wiring fault. They can also find a GFCI issue, overloaded circuit, or panel problem.

The technician may compare the dead outlet with nearby outlets. They may inspect the receptacle terminals. They may also test points before and after the outlet. Continuity testing happens only on a circuit with power off. The technician checks line and load terminals with care. Wrong connections can affect safety and nearby outlets.

Diagnostic check What it can show
Voltage tester Whether usable voltage reaches the receptacle
Continuity testing Whether a de-energized conductor or connection is complete
Line and load terminals Whether protection and downstream connections are arranged correctly
Neutral conductor Whether an open neutral or loose termination is interrupting operation
Electrical panel Whether the breaker, bus connection, or circuit protection is involved

This full-circuit check matters. Outlet replacement, breaker replacement, and wiring repair fix different problems. It can also support an electrical code correction. That may be needed when an installation is unsafe or old.

Repair Options for a Dead or Damaged Outlet

Outlet replacement may help when a receptacle is worn, cracked, burned, or broken inside. Other repairs may fix a loose connection or bad breaker. They may also fix reversed polarity, an open neutral, or damaged wiring. The electrician chooses the repair after testing. They’ll check safe operation before putting the outlet back in use.

Replacing a circuit breaker won’t explain why it trips. The team must find the cause first. They must confirm the breaker fits the circuit. They must also confirm the wiring can carry the load safely. Other work may include AFCI protection, GFCI protection, or an electrical code correction.

We may suggest a new receptacle, wiring repair, or larger circuit work. The choice depends on test results and circuit design. It also depends on the device and wiring condition. Replacing only the visible outlet may leave the real fault active.

Preventing Future Outlet Failures

Good habits can reduce stress on outlets. They can also help you spot trouble early. These steps don’t replace an inspection when damage appears.

  • Manage electrical load: Don’t run several high-wattage appliances on one circuit.
  • Test GFCI protection: Use the test and reset buttons as directed. Request service if the device won’t reset.
  • Check outlet covers, plugs, and cords for cracks, heat, or dark spots.
  • Use extension cords for short-term needs only. Match the cord to the load. Never cover cords with rugs or furniture.

Early repairs can stop a loose connection from becoming a burned outlet. They may also prevent a larger wiring failure.

Why Did One Outlet Stop Working but the Others Are Fine?

One outlet may have a failed receptacle, loose wire, or open neutral. A GFCI may also have cut power downstream. A tripped breaker can affect part of a circuit. If a reset doesn’t restore power, an electrician should test the full circuit.

How Do I Reset an Outlet That Has No Power?

Look for a nearby GFCI receptacle. Press its reset button once. Then check the electrical panel. Move the suspected breaker fully off and on once. Stop if it won’t reset or trips again.

Can a Tripped GFCI Cause Other Outlets to Stop Working?

Yes. A GFCI can cut power to outlets farther along the same circuit. Check nearby bathrooms, kitchens, garages, and laundry areas. Also check basements and outdoor locations. Professional diagnosis is needed if the GFCI won’t reset.

Is a Dead Outlet Dangerous if the Circuit Breaker Is Not Tripped?

It can be dangerous. The fault may involve loose wires, damaged wiring, or an open neutral. A failed receptacle or hidden live part may also cause trouble. Don’t remove the outlet unless you’re qualified. Turn off power when possible. Arrange a professional check if you see heat, smoke, odor, buzzing, water, or repeated power loss.
